2 attorneys (D) launch campaigns challenging GOP-appointed justices on Georgia's highest court

Two prominent attorneys have launched campaigns for the Georgia Supreme Court, challenging two sitting justices who were originally appointed by former Republican Gov. Nathan Deal.

Former Democratic state Sen. Jen Jordan and Miracle Rankin, a personal injury attorney and former president of the Georgia Association of Black Women Attorneys, stood together Tuesday at Liberty Plaza outside the state Capitol. The two left-leaning candidates pledged to protect basic rights that they argued are under attack.

Jordan is challenging Presiding Justice Sarah Hawkins Warren, and Rankin will take on Justice Charlie Bethel. Warren and Bethel were both appointed to the court in 2018 and then reelected to a six-year term in 2020. Bethel served as a GOP state senator from north Georgia before joining the bench.

“I’m not just going to sit down and do nothing because someone has to stand up for Georgia’s civil liberties that are being stripped away,” Rankin said.
